Cass County Michigan Biographies
From The History of Cass County by Glover:
On the 14th of November, 1850, Mr. Banks was united in marriage to Miss Amanda Norton, the second daughter of Pleasant Norton. She was born December 22, 1831, in Champaign county, Ohio, and was brought to Michigan by her aunt, Mattie Norton, when she was six months old, the journey being made on a pony to Jefferson township, Cass county. Mrs. Banks remained a lifelong resident of this county, and passed away September 4, 1893. She had become the mother of three children: James K., who is now cashier of the First National Bank of Sheldon, North Dakota; Emma J., the wife of M. L. Howell, a prominent attorney of Cassopolis, whom she married October 11, 1870; and Cora L., who on the 4th of September, 1886, became the wife of Alfred T. Osmer.

1880 Cassopolis, Cass County, Michigan she is age 12 and living with her parents.

Cora married Alfred T. Osmer, son of James Osmer and Hannah E. Straw, on 4 Sep 1886. (Alfred T. Osmer was born on 23 Jan 1862 in Michigan.)
